DMs: I'm curious how you handle HP per level by ScubaDiggs in dndnext

[–]dolphinman101 0 points1 point  (0 children)

A little homebrew thing I like to do at my table is have the player and the DM each roll for hitpoints. The DM’s roll is hidden and the player gets to choose if they want the DM’s roll or their roll. If they roll a 1 then they can always go for my roll, but if they roll a 4 then it’s a fun little gamble to see if I got higher or lower.
